Abstract

Judgments of agency, our sense of control over our actions and the environment, are often assumed to be metacognitive. We examined this assumption at the computational level by comparing the effects of sensory noise on agency judgments to those on confidence judgements, which are widely accepted to be metacognitive in nature. In two tasks, participants rated agency, or confidence in a decision about their agency, over a virtual hand that tracked their movements, either synchronously or with a delay, under high and low noise. We compared the predictions of two computational models to participants’ ratings and found that agency ratings, unlike confidence, were best explained by a model involving no metacognitive noise estimates. We propose that agency judgments reflect first-order measures of the internal signal, without involving metacognitive computations, challenging the assumed link between the two cognitive processes.
